Summary
Anonymous caricatures, not listed in Mary Dorothy George, Catalogue of political and personal satires preserved in the Department of Prints and Drawings in the British Museum. Includes satires on dandies, fashion, first aid to animals, political parties, shaving and voting. No. 8 shows British redcoats breaking up a meeting in Ireland. Nos. 12 & 13 depict the comedian John Liston. Other individuals depicted include George IV, William IV and the fictional characters John Bull and Paul Pry.
